A movie theater earned $3,600 in sold-out ticket sales for the premiere of a new movie. VIP tickets cost $20 per person and regu

lar admission tickets cost $8 per person. If the number of regular admission tickets sold was twice the number of VIP tickets sold, what was the total number of seats in the theater?

There are 300 seats in the theater.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given,

Cost of one VIP ticket = $20

Cost of one regular ticket = $8

Worth of sold out tickets = $3600

Let,

x represent the number of VIP tickets sold

y represent the number of regular tickets sold

20x+8y=3600     Eqn 1

y = 2x                   Eqn 2

Putting value of y from Eqn 2 in Eqn 1

20x+8(2x)=3600\\20x+16x=3600\\36x=3600

Dividing both sides by 36

\frac{36x}{36}=\frac{3600}{36}\\x=100

Putting x=100 in Eqn 2

y=2(100)\\y=200

Total = x+y = 100+200 = 300

There are 300 seats in the theater.
